Stivichall deeds and papers

Description

Lease and release, the release a conveyance from William Jesson of Rhodly Temple, co. Leics., esq., son and heir of Sir William Jesson, late of Newhouse in Coventry, knight, deceased, to Stephen Norris of Coventry, perukmaker, and Anne his wife, for 36 pounds, of a cottage, barn, garden and backside in Stivechall now in the occupation of Bennett Welton; to hold the same for ever of the chief lord of the fee. Signed: William Jesson. Red seal applied on tag; armorial. Three falcons' heads erased between a fess embattled. Witnesses: Tho. Bywater, Tho. Murcott, Tho. Cookes junior. Endorsed: 897) William Jesson esq. to Stephen Norris, lease for a yeare 898) William Jesson esq. to Stephen Norris, release
